Rape charge for high society internet tycoon Lawrence Jones


A British tech tycoon who counts the rich and famous as friends has been charged with rape and sexual assault. Lawrence Jones, 52, who is said to be worth £700 million, founded the internet hosting service UK Fast and was its chief executive until he stepped down in 2019 after allegations by female colleagues made during an investigation by the Financial Times. They had included inappropriate physical contact, verbal abuse and bullying, which he denied at the time. The company, based in Manchester, had been ranked as one of the top ten places to work in Britain. Greater Manchester police said yesterday that Mr Jones, who lives in Hale Barns, a village near Altrincham, had been charged with one rape and four sexual assaults.
